International Financial Advisors Holding KPSC Business Description

Other Exchanges IFA:Kuwait
Address Al Abdul Razzak Square, Block A - Floor 8, PO Box 4694, Souk Al-Kuwait Building, Safat, Kuwait, KWT, 13047
International Financial Advisors Holding KPSC is a Kuwait-based company engaged in a wide range of investment activities, including providing financial advisory services, trading in local and international securities, and offering borrowing, lending, and guarantee issuance services. The company is also involved in managing investment funds and providing portfolio management solutions. The Group operates through three segments, namely Treasury and Investments, Real Estate, and Others, with the Treasury and Investments segment generating the highest revenue. Geographically, it operates across Kuwait, the GCC, and Asia, with Kuwait contributing the highest share of revenue.
